Don Jazzy reunites with D’banj for new album

Famous Nigerian singers, D’banj and Don Jazzy have reunited to release a new album ‘The Entertainer Sequel’.

D’banj who made the announcement on his Instagram page, sharing the video of a short play featuring Don Jazzy, TV host Jimmie Akinsola, actor Gideon Okeke and others.

The album, which is a follow up to D’banj’s 2008 ‘The Entertainer’ album, includes remixes of popular songs like ‘Fall in Love’, ‘Feli Feli’, ‘Igwe’ and ‘Suddenly’.

DAILY POST reports that D’Banj became famous after the release of his first hit, ‘No Long Thing’, in 2005.

He worked with Don Jazzy at a music label they both co-founded, ‘Mo’Hits Records’, before their fall out.
